The Swans followed it up with the next selection by bidding for Adelaide father-son father-son Max Michalanney, who the Crows hoped would slide to the second round, which compelled the South Australian side into Tuesday night trading. Sydney on night one bid on GWS Academy product Harry Rowston with Pick 16, forcing the Giants to match with their first rounder instead of using several second and third-round picks. When they matched, because GWS lost a pick, it brought our second pick in by one, so we though theres an opportunity here to trade, get some trade collateral for next year and just move back a little bit, so we were happy to look at that with the Hawks.. Sydney have made the equal-second-most bids (six), with Adelaide, Western Bulldogs and North Melbourne, since the AFL introduced the system in 2015.
